Quick Overview

Each year Trapiche selects their top three growers of the vintage out of 100 innitial selections and honors them with a special bottling. These wines have proven over the past few years to be among the finest values in high-class Malbec.


Yields are a low 2,600 kg per hectare, furrow irrigation is used and the vines have been planted on their own rootstocks. Vineyard soils are alluvial and sandy, with many pebbles. Grapes are hand harvested into 20 kg. plastic cases, and bunches are selected before de-stemming. There’s a strict berry selection before fermentation and maceration in small concrete vats, for a minimum of 23 days, at 23-25ºC. Natural malolactic fermentation precedes aging for 18 months in new French oak barrels.


 

Product Description

Robert Parker 92: Wine Advocate # 184 Aug 2009 - Reviewer Jay Miller - The 2007 Malbec Single Vineyard Vina Adolfo Ahumada is purple-colored with a fragrant bouquet of sandalwood, spice box, incense, espresso, black cherry, and plum. Dense and layered on the palate, it has loads of succulent, spicy black fruit, underlying structure, and a lengthy, pure finish. Give it 3-4 years and drink it through 2022.

Tasting note This Malbec has a deep, ruby color with aromas of ripe, black cherries and spicy notes of inciense and sandalwood. Full-bodied in the mouth, with nuances of candied black-fruit. A long finish that is pure and balanced with sweet tannins and fresh acidity.
Serving suggestions Ideal to serve with dishes prepared with red meats and game cooked in a plow disc, hard cheeses and smoked cold cuts.
Serving temperature 17°-19° C
